Certificates of Deposit (CDs)
Certificates of Deposit (CDs) serve as a secure investment option for individuals looking to grow their savings with fixed interest rates over a specified term.
These financial instruments provide predictable returns, making them a popular choice in investment strategies. Investors can lock in advantageous interest rates, thereby enhancing their savings while minimizing risk, which aligns with a desire for financial freedom and stability.
Money Market Accounts
Many individuals seeking a flexible and low-risk way to grow their savings turn to Money Market Accounts (MMAs).
These accounts offer significant money market benefits, including competitive interest rates and the ability to access funds easily.
With higher limits on withdrawals compared to traditional savings accounts, MMAs combine security and liquidity, making them an appealing option for those prioritizing account accessibility while cultivating their savings.
